```[next-auth][error][NO_SECRET] docker-calcom-1 ...
# docker
c
Copy code
[next-auth][error][NO_SECRET] 
docker-calcom-1  | @calcom/web:start: <https://next-auth.js.org/errors#no_secret> Please define a `secret` in production. MissingSecret [MissingSecretError]: Please define a `secret` in production.
docker-calcom-1  | @calcom/web:start:     at assertConfig (/calcom/node_modules/next-auth/core/lib/assert.js:26:14)
docker-calcom-1  | @calcom/web:start:     at NextAuthHandler (/calcom/node_modules/next-auth/core/index.js:34:52)
docker-calcom-1  | @calcom/web:start:     at NextAuthNextHandler (/calcom/node_modules/next-auth/next/index.js:21:51)
docker-calcom-1  | @calcom/web:start:     at /calcom/node_modules/next-auth/next/index.js:57:38
docker-calcom-1  | @calcom/web:start:     at Object.apiResolver (/calcom/node_modules/next/dist/server/api-utils/node.js:184:15)
docker-calcom-1  | @calcom/web:start:     at runMicrotasks (<anonymous>)
docker-calcom-1  | @calcom/web:start:     at processTicksAndRejections (internal/process/task_queues.js:95:5)
docker-calcom-1  | @calcom/web:start:     at async NextNodeServer.runApi (/calcom/node_modules/next/dist/server/next-server.js:395:9)
docker-calcom-1  | @calcom/web:start:     at async Object.fn (/calcom/node_modules/next/dist/server/base-server.js:477:37)
docker-calcom-1  | @calcom/web:start:     at async Router.execute (/calcom/node_modules/next/dist/server/router.js:243:32) {
docker-calcom-1  | @calcom/web:start:   code: 'NO_SECRET'
docker-calcom-1  | @calcom/web:start: }